Title

Study on the quantity and quality of two Nepeta species (Nepeta cataria L. and N. bracteata Benth. ) essential oil under agricultural conditions

Pages

  113-126

Abstract

 Two species Nepeta cataria L. and Nepeta bracteata Benth. (fam. lamiaceae) are native to Iran. To study the quantity and quality of the two species essential oil in the field, the seeds of eight populations from these two species were collected from natural habitats and planted in a randomized complete block design in Alborz Research Station of Research Institute of Forests and Rangelands (Karaj, Alborz province). The flowering branches were harvested at the full flowering stage and after room temperature-drying, their essential oils were extracted by hydrodistillation, and analyzed and identified by GC and GC/MS. The essential oil yield of N. cataria populations varied between 0. 02 (Karaj) and 0. 50% (Arak). Twenty-three compounds were identified in the essential oil of this species, and the main compound in all populations was from nepetalactone isomers. nepetalactoneIII (4aα , 7β , 7aα-nepetalactone) and nepetalactoneI (4aα , 7α , 7aα-nepetalactone) constituted 44. 4 (Karaj) to 91. 6% (Arak) and 0. 8 (Karaj) to 15. 9% (Bafgh1) of the essential oil, respectively. nepetalactoneII (4aα , 7α , 7aβ-nepetalactone) was observed only in the population Bafgh2 (21. 2%). The amount of 1, 8-cineole in the essential oil of different N. cataria populations varied from 0. 4 (Taft1) to 12. 8% (Karaj). The essential oil yield of N. bractaeta populations was obtained between 0. 02 (Ardakan) and 0. 70% (Taft2). Twenty-seven compounds were identified in the essential oil of this species, and the main compounds were 1, 8-cineole (1. 0, 9. 6, and 41. 0% in Tabas, Ardakan, and Taft2, respectively) and geranyl acetate (0. 9, 3. 4, and 39. 8% in Tabas, Taft2, and Ardakan, respectively). In general, the results showed that the N. cataria populations were all from the same chemotype, but N. bracteata populations were from two chemotypes (ct. geranyl acetate and ct. 1, 8-cineole).
